Implementation of the time delay and integration mode in a scanning 576 × 6 focal-plane array of the long-wave infrared range

Abstract

The results of the development of a focal-plane array (FPA) of the 576 × 6 format with the time delay and integration (TDI) mode are presented. The comparative analysis of different variants of implementation of the TDI mode in ROIC is conducted. The expedience of the upgrade of existing scanning photodetectors of the 288 × 4 format on the basis of the developed 576 × 6 FPA is justified. The result of this upgrade will be simplification of the optical–mechanical scanning unit and improvement of the quality of thermal image.
